What Is the Best Way to Upgrade to PostgreSQL 18?
The best method depends on database size, downtime tolerance, and current version.
Use pg_upgrade When You Need Fast Upgrades
Best for:
- Same server migrations
- Minimal downtime windows
- Large production databases
- Fast rollback planning
Use Logical Replication When Near-Zero Downtime Is Required
Best for:
- Critical systems
- Blue-green deployments
- Cross-server upgrades
- Version transitions with live sync
Use Dump and Restore for Smaller Databases
Best for:
- Small environments
- Cleanup projects
- Rebuilding corrupted systems
- Simpler migrations

Pre-Upgrade Checklist
Before starting postgresql 18 how to upgrade, complete these checks.
1. Full Backup
Create verified backups using pg_dump or filesystem snapshots.
2. Review Extensions
Check PostGIS, pg_partman, TimescaleDB, pg_cron, and other installed extensions.
3. Test Application Compatibility
Validate ORM drivers, connection pools, reporting tools, and custom SQL.
4. Measure Downtime Window
Know how long shutdown, copy, validation, and restart may take.
5. Review Disk Space
You need free storage for binaries, temp files, WAL growth, and backups.
Postgresql 18 How to Upgrade Using pg_upgrade
This is the preferred method for most production systems.
Step 1: Install PostgreSQL 18
Install PostgreSQL 18 packages without removing the old version.
Step 2: Stop Application Writes
Put the application into maintenance mode.
Step 3: Stop Old PostgreSQL Service
sudo systemctl stop postgresql
Step 4: Run Compatibility Check
pg_upgrade –check \
-d /var/lib/postgresql/17/main \
-D /var/lib/postgresql/18/main \
-b /usr/lib/postgresql/17/bin \
-B /usr/lib/postgresql/18/bin
Step 5: Run Upgrade
pg_upgrade \
-d /var/lib/postgresql/17/main \
-D /var/lib/postgresql/18/main \
-b /usr/lib/postgresql/17/bin \
-B /usr/lib/postgresql/18/bin
Step 6: Analyze Database
vacuumdb –all –analyze-in-stages
Step 7: Start PostgreSQL 18
Point services to the new cluster and validate connections.
Postgresql 18 How to Upgrade Ubuntu
Ubuntu users often use apt repositories.
Ubuntu Upgrade Steps
sudo apt update
sudo apt install postgresql-18
Check installed clusters:
pg_lsclusters
Upgrade using pg_upgradecluster or pg_upgrade depending on your environment.
sudo pg_upgradecluster 17 main
Then verify:
psql –version

Zero Downtime Upgrade Strategy
If downtime is unacceptable, use logical replication.
Process
- Build PostgreSQL 18 target server
- Create schema on target
- Start replication from old server
- Sync lag to zero
- Pause writes briefly
- Switch applications to PostgreSQL 18
- Monitor performance

Common Upgrade Errors
Extension Version Mismatch
Install compatible versions before cutover.
Insufficient Disk Space
Temporary files and copied data can stop the upgrade.
Invalid Collation Warnings
Rebuild indexes if OS locale changed.
Old Drivers Fail to Connect
Update JDBC, psycopg, Npgsql, or ORM connectors.
Poor Performance After Upgrade
Run analyze, review plans, and tune memory settings.

Performance Tuning After Upgrade
Do not keep old settings blindly.
Review:
- shared_buffers
- work_mem
- maintenance_work_mem
- effective_cache_size
- max_connections
- autovacuum thresholds
New versions often behave better with fresh tuning.
